How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Yalesville?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Yalesville Studio Apartments | $1,589 | $1,250 | $2,011 |
Yalesville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,789 | $1,250 | $2,450 |
Yalesville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,200 | $1,275 | $2,700 |
Yalesville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,033 | $1,800 | $2,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Yalesville
How much are Studio apartments in Yalesville?
There are currently 12 Studio Apartments in Yalesville with rent ranges from $1,250 to $2,011 with an average price of $1,589.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Yalesville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Yalesville ranges from $1,250 to $2,450 with an average monthly rent of $1,789.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Yalesville c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Yalesville range from $1,275 to $2,700.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,200.
How expensive are Yalesville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 4 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Yalesville on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,800 to $2,500 - averaging $2,033 for the location.
